Output 5118333f066fb949954ef17bd380037887624b5f2a3bf2de8bc30d437959cab9:0

value
18382522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a564cb5e896f5492592841a582afa71e40fbb6f5 OP_EQUAL
address
MNygUQC8rWk31EGra7gvFpBaRZV2HBuvqF
transaction
5118333f066fb949954ef17bd380037887624b5f2a3bf2de8bc30d437959cab9
spent
true